Abstract
A gyroscope system for obtaining an extended linear dynamic range for platform rotation rate measurements comprising a first fiber optic gyroscope with a first optical fiber coil described by a first quantity L.sub.1 R.sub.1 /.lambda..sub.1 where L.sub.1 is the length of the first optical fiber coil, R.sub.1 is the radius of the first fiber coil, and .lambda..sub.1 is the light source wavelength, this first quantity being chosen to provide a linear output for a first range of small rotation rates of the platform; a second fiber optic gyroscope with a second optical fiber coil described by a second quantity L.sub.2 R.sub.2 /.lambda..sub.2 with this second quantity being chosen to provide a linear output for a second range of large rotation rates of the platform, with this second range partially overlapping the first range; voltage controlled oscillators for converting the gyroscope signals to pulse frequency signals; a circuit for determining whether a reference rotation rate within the overlap between the first and second ranges has been reached and generating a control signal in accordance therewith; a pulse counter; and a switch for switching one or the other of the pulse frequen…
